This article is written by Brother Abdul-Kareem In answer to this there are two factors that need to be considered for someone to be suitable for a ruling position in the Khilafah - capability and strength of ideology. Capability to Rule Capability in carrying out the task of ruling is an explicit shar'i (Iegal) condition for the Khaleefah, Assistants (mu'awinoon) and the governors (wulah). This ruling capability is manifested in certain traits that will enable the person to fulfil the responsibilities of office and manage the affairs of state. These traits are strength of personality, consciousness of Allah (taqwa), kindness and that he should not be one who causes aversion. 1. Strength of personality - The Prophet Muhammad صلى الله عليه وسلم stipulated that the ruler must be strong and that the weak person is not suitable to become a ruler.
